What Should You Do After an Accident in Ocala?

The steps you take immediately after an accident may help protect both your recovery and your legal interests. Although every situation is different, there are several practical actions that are often beneficial.

After an accident, consider:

  • Seeking medical attention as soon as possible.
  • Reporting the accident to the appropriate authorities.
  • Taking photographs of the accident scene and your injuries.
  • Collecting witness names and contact information.
  • Saving medical records, receipts, and repair estimates.
  • Avoiding detailed conversations with insurance adjusters before understanding your rights.
  • Speaking with a personal injury attorney.

Prompt medical care is important because some injuries may not become fully apparent until hours or even days after an accident.

What You Need to Know About Florida Personal Injury Laws

Florida law contains several important rules that may affect your personal injury claim.

Florida PIP Laws

Florida requires most motorists to carry Personal Injury Protection (PIP) insurance. Following many motor vehicle accidents, PIP provides certain medical and wage-loss benefits regardless of who caused the collision.

When injuries are serious enough to satisfy Florida law, additional compensation may be available through a claim against the responsible party. Understanding how insurance coverage applies to your case can become complicated, making experienced legal guidance especially valuable.

Florida’s Modified Comparative Negligence Laws

Florida follows a modified comparative negligence system. If multiple parties contributed to an accident, responsibility may be divided among those involved.

The percentage of fault assigned may affect whether compensation is available and how damages are calculated. Every claim deserves a careful evaluation based on its specific facts and available evidence.

Filing Deadlines Matter

Florida law establishes deadlines for filing personal injury lawsuits. Missing these deadlines may affect your ability to pursue compensation. Speaking with an attorney early can help preserve evidence while ensuring important legal requirements are addressed.

What Compensation May Be Available?

Depending on the circumstances of your case, compensation may include medical expenses, lost wages, future medical treatment, pain and suffering, property damage, and other damages recognized under Florida law.

Do Most Personal Injury Cases Go to Trial?

Many personal injury claims are resolved through negotiated settlements. If a fair resolution cannot be reached, litigation may become necessary to protect your interests.
